Is Gold Medal Bread Flour Halal?

Yes, Gold Medal Bread Flour is considered Halal. Based on the ingredient label, it contains no animal-derived ingredients, alcohol, or other non-Halal substances. It is a safe choice for Muslim bakers looking to make bread at home.

The Ingredient Breakdown

When determining if a baking product is Halal, we look for hidden animal derivatives, alcohol, or impure additives. Gold Medal Bread Flour keeps it simple. Let's look at the core components.

The primary ingredient is Wheat flour. This is a plant-based grain and is naturally Halal. It provides the structure for bread.

Next, we have a list of vitamins: niacin, iron, thiamine mononitrate, riboflavin, and folic acid. These are synthetic or isolated vitamins added to fortify the flour. They are not derived from animals and pose no Halal issues.

The most scrutinized ingredient is usually enzymes. In baking, enzymes are used to improve dough handling and loaf volume. While enzymes can sometimes be derived from animal sources, the enzymes used in mass-market US flours like Gold Medal are almost exclusively derived from non-animal sources (often fungal or bacterial fermentation). There are no flags on this product regarding enzymes.

Overall, the formulation is clean and plant-based.


Nutritional Value

Gold Medal Bread Flour is a refined carbohydrate. A standard serving contains roughly 100-110 calories, primarily from carbohydrates (21-23g). It contains less than 1g of fat and 3-4g of protein per serving.

Because it is enriched, it provides a good amount of Iron and B vitamins, which are essential for energy levels. It fits well into most dietary limits, provided you are monitoring your carbohydrate intake. It is low in sugar (0g) and contains no added sweeteners.
